A friend of mine posted this from Japan. I thought it was cute. Not sure if I agree with all of them, but it’s a fun chart! Check it out for yourself, then go get your favorite drink from your favorite shop. All rights to the article and picture are the sole property of DailyInfographic…
You must be logged in to post a comment.